SetupDiGetDeviceRegistryPropertyA

関数
デバイスのPlug and Playレジストリプロパティを取得する。
DLLSETUPAPI.dll文字セットANSI (-A)呼出規約winapiSetLastErrorあり対応OSWindows 2000 以降

シグネチャ

// SETUPAPI.dll  (ANSI / -A)
#include <windows.h>

BOOL SetupDiGetDeviceRegistryPropertyA(
    HDEVINFO DeviceInfoSet,
    SP_DEVINFO_DATA* DeviceInfoData,
    SETUP_DI_REGISTRY_PROPERTY Property,
    DWORD* PropertyRegDataType,   // optional
    BYTE* PropertyBuffer,   // optional
    DWORD PropertyBufferSize,
    DWORD* RequiredSize   // optional
);

パラメーター

名前方向
DeviceInfoSetHDEVINFOin
DeviceInfoDataSP_DEVINFO_DATA*in
PropertySETUP_DI_REGISTRY_PROPERTYin
PropertyRegDataTypeDWORD*outoptional
PropertyBufferBYTE*outoptional
PropertyBufferSizeDWORDin
RequiredSizeDWORD*outoptional

戻り値の型: BOOL
